The revelation of Geregu Power Plc default on its bond obligations shocked Nigerians when it became public in late July 2026. Consequently, the FMDQ Securities Exchange -- the market infrastructure provider -- identified Geregu’s N409.09 billion senior unsecured bond as being in "credit default" early August.
